Breaking Free: The Benefits and Risks of Taking a Gap Year in Today's Russia

Taking a 'gap year' - a year off after high school - is a choice that carries both advantages and drawbacks, especially in a place like Russia where education and career paths are often shaped by societal norms and economic factors. Let's explore the highs and lows of embarking on a gap year in the Russian context.

Going for a Spin: The Upsides of a Gap Year in Russia

  1. Self-Discovery Matters
  2. A gap year offers a precious opportunity for individuals to refocus, explore their interests, and determine their career goals. This is significant in a system where students often specialize early.
  3. It fosters personal growth through travel, volunteering, or internships, arms students with valuable skills such as independence and adaptability.
  4. Career Clarity and Preparation
  5. Select gap year programs in Russia provide vocational training and professional certifications, offering a competitive edge in an aggressive job market.
  6. Internships or work placements give students practical experience, making them appealing candidates for universities and employers.
  7. Brain Reaper: Academic Refreshment
  8. For students worn out from the grueling Russian high school curriculum, a gap year provides a much-needed rest and chance to recharge before diving into university.

Navigating the Potholes: The Downsides of a Gap Year in Russia

  1. Rigid Screws
  2. The inflexible Russian education system can be disrupted by a gap year, potentially jeopardizing plans for early entry into prestigious universities or specialized programs that have competitive admission processes.
  3. Certain programs or scholarships might demand continuous academic advancement without breaks.
  4. Coin Crunch and Job Market Pressure
  5. The increasing cost of living and the perceived necessity of continuous education or employment in Russia's competitive job market may make a gap year expensive or unfeasible for many families.
  6. There's a risk of falling behind peers who continue directly into higher education or career paths, reducing job prospects.
  7. Social Expectations and Career Momentum
  8. Russian society often harbors strong expectations of sticking to traditional educational paths, which might view taking a gap year as unconventional and potentially impact future career prospects.
  9. Momentum achieved during high school might stall if not channeled into immediate academic or professional advancements.

Taking Control: Strategies to Conquer Gap Year Challenges

To counter these challenges, potential gap year takers should:

  • Plan, Plan, Plan: Establish a clear purpose for the gap year, whether it's academic, personal, or professional advancement.
  • Choose Structured Programs: Utilize reputable gap year programs with vocational training, educational experiences that cater to future career aspirations.
  • Stay Sharp: Engage in academic activities during the gap year to maintain skills or explore related fields through online courses or workshops.
  • Network and Make Connections: Take advantage of the gap year to build professional relationships and collect recommendations that can aid in future university applications or job hunts.

By adopting a strategic approach, individuals can optimize the advantages of a gap year while minimizing its risks in the face of Russia's educational landscape.
